After you successfully cast a spell while using this staff and before rolling damage you can choose to roll 1d6:
1 or 2: your spell automatically fails
3 or 4: your spell has its normal effect
5: Your spell deals double the damage. If it doesn't deal damage the duration of it gets doubled. Roll any dice like normal and add all boni, then double it.
6: Your spell has its normal effect. You also regain your spell slot.
This item ignores all abilitys, class features and all other rules which let you skip your dice roll or affect your dice roll in any way, unless specifically stated otherwise by your DM.
Scorching Ray: to be able to roll a d6 at least 50% of your rays have to hit. The effect of the staff counts for the entire spell, not for individual ray's. If less then 50% hit, the effects are as normal. This rule also applies for all other spells with mutiple projectiles or similar effects.
Befav, a halve ork, created his very own staff at a young age, but the desing was flawed and unbalanced. Befav's mind degenerated over time to the point where he couldn't tell the difference between a Staff and a Wand anymore and started to cast the weirdest spells. Despite this, Befav's strength in combat was unmached... on a good day. Some wizards and Philosophers, who had too much time, suggested that the uncontrolable nature of Befav's staff had something to do with his dwindeling intellect. A good 20 years after his death a Warlock, fed up with the false name and uncontrolable nature of this staff, combined it with an actual wand, creating this unique staff.
